Check out the top sticky about gravity being toxic I personally wouldnt use the hco additives if your using the full hg line additives they're pretty complete in terms of what you want besides base nutes

If your using the whole hg line might as well just use hg base nutes as well, cutting edge is more overpriced IMO at least hg is sort of concentrated... Look at CE mag amp it's like super over priced Epsom salt

Kiss is the way to go man less is more when you add soo much your chances of messing up ratios and making mistakes increases
